Which disease or disorder occurs when blood sugar levels become too low? diabetes hypoglycemia hypothyroidism hyperthyroidism
Doss [256]

Answer:

Hypoglycemia

Explanation:

Hypoglycemia occurs when your blood sugar (glucose) levels drop too low. It's usually the side effect of drugs used to treat diabetes.
